Menu

Michael DOUBEZ

PARIS

En résumé

Je suis ingénieur spécialisé dans le développement d'applications critiques sous Linux.

Aussi bien à Everbee qu'à INFOTRON, je me suis impliqué dans toutes les phases du projet: des spécifications initiales à la mise en production et commercialisation du produit. Ainsi, j'ai une vue globale et une expérience intime de l'ensemble du cycle de vie d'un produit informatique. Je mets à profit cette expérience pour travailler efficacement et faire avancer le projet, que je sois autonome ou en équipe.

Techniquement, je maitrise le C (C89 et C99) et le C++ (C++98 et en partie le C++11) en environnement LINUX (g++, Makefile et outils associés). Je continue à mettre à jour mes connaissances en design et à les partager en participant aux groupes de discussion USENET et dans une moindre mesure ACCU (http://accu.org/ ).

Un point fort de ma formation est une approche pluridisciplinaire des domaines d'application de l'informatique (IIE) et une expérience du processus de recherche fondamentale(MSc). Je suis donc aussi familier des problématiques de la recherche que du développement et de la mise en production d'un produit innovant. Cette alliance me permet de participer à ou de seconder efficacement une équipe dans la réalisation, la faisabilité et la commercialisation de produits de pointe.

Enfin, mon moteur est la résolution de problème et la fierté d'avoir mené un projet à bien. Je recherche le lieu où je pourrai mobiliser avec plaisir mon énergie et valoriser mon expérience.

NOTE: vous pouvez aussi consulter mon profil en anglais sur LinkedIn
http://www.linkedin.com/in/michaeldoubez

Mes compétences :
Design
Design Patterns
Finance
Finance de marché
Linux
Python
C++
Ingénierie

Entreprises

  • Société Générale - Technical Leader

    PARIS 2015 - maintenant Teechnical Leader ITEC/CTT/TRA Market Access
  • QuantHouse - Technical Leader

    2011 - 2015
  • Banque Cheuvreux - Ingénieur développement

    2009 - 2011 Développement de Feedhandler:
    * Nasdaq ITCH
    * LSE Millenium
    * CHI-X ITCH

    Maintenance et améliorations des bibliothèques coeur.
  • INFOTRON - Ingénieur R&D système embarqué

    2006 - 2009 INFOTRON développe un drone civil à décollage vertical (VTOL). Le produit actuel est un drone de type hélicoptère à rotors contrarotatifs. Il existe en version thermique et en version électrique.
    La partie informatique est segmentée en deux unité: une carte de vol agissant sur les capteurs et les effecteurs et une carte pour le logiciel de plus haut niveau (navigation, gestion des modules).
    Je suis en charge du logiciel embarqué de haut niveau et j'interviens régulièrement dans le code de la carte de vol.

    Missions:
    --------
    * Réaliser et intégrer les fonctionnalités de haut niveau dans le drone.
    * Réaliser et distribuer les interface de commande et de contrôle sol du drone.
    * Réaliser l'interface et intégrer les modules manipulés par le drone (caméra, appareil photo ...)

    Réalisations:
    -------------
    * Embarquer linux sur la carte de haut niveau.
    * Protocole et code pour assurer la liaison entre le drone et la station sol.
    * Interface de monitoring et de contrôle dans la station sol.
    * Capteur de flux optique.
  • Everbee Networks - Ingénieur R&D système embarqué

    pessac 2000 - 2006 Everbee Networks était une Start-Up fondée en 1999 par un ami d'école ( de l'IIE.) pour réaliser un firewall hardware. Le projet originel consistait en la réalisation d'une puce (SoC) réalisant toutes les fonctions de sécurité (filtrage, cryptage) en coupure sur le fil. Les applications envisagées étaient la sécurisation des réseaux (VPN dynamiques, segmentation logicielle des réseaux ...) et la création de VPN mobiles. Puis le produit a été réorienté vers un produit grand public (firewall, contrôle parente) commercialisé sous le nom de Zenbow. Enfin, nous avons ouvert un pôle conseil en sécurité informatique et développé la Data Secure Key visant à créer des disques durs virtuels chiffrés sous Windows XP.

    Missions:
    ---------
    Comme dans beaucoup de petites structures et particulièrement dans les start-up, j'ai porté beaucoup de casquettes mais les principales ont été:
    * Ingénieur R&D: j'ai activement participé à la réalisation technique du produit (firewall embarqué et Zenbow) et assumé le lead technologique sur ces deux produits.
    * Management: pendant deux ans (les deux premières années) j'ai géré le groupe "Système embarqué" en parallèle avec mes responsabilités techniques. J'ai ensuite assuré la gestion des projets client pour l'intégration de notre produit et les projets de service; les budgets étaient en moyenne de 30-40k€.
    * Expertise/Avant-vente: en sus des projets clients, j'ai assuré l'expertise sur nos produits. En avant-vente sous la forme d'accompagnement du commercial et par la réalisation de whitepapers. Et en interne en tant qu'architecte et recherche/veille technologique.

    Réalisation techniques:
    -----------------------
    * Firewall hardware distributé (système embarqué). En particulier:
    - Le protocole et le système de communication avec le serveur central. Le protocole était un système propriétaire au dessus de TCP permettant des sessions simultanées mixées sur un seul flux avec un système de priorité des flux. Environnement technique: C, Linux, TCP/IP, socket.
    - l'architecture du produit, le système de build et l'infrastructure d'encadrement du projet (version control, defect management, ...). Environnement technique: CVS, SVN, wiki, Makefile, Bash script, ARM tools.
    - la réalisation d'un émulateur sous linux permettant le développement des modules en dehors de l'architecture matérielle. Le but principal étaient d'avoir un système plus efficace de debug et de ne pas avoir de dépendance sur la disposition du hardware. Environnement technique: C, Linux, RTOS.

    * Contrôle parental: le but était de construire une base de donné classifiant les URI et de s'en servir pour améliorer le contrôle parental.
    - Architecte: définition technique du projet (fonctions et qualités). Environnement technique: UML, SDL.
    - Réalisation d'un crawler intégré avec un système de rating de page développé par la société Adamentium (http://www.adamentium.com/). Environnement technique: C++, Linux (redhat), TCP/IP, socket, tolérance de panne, haute disponibilité, massivement multi-threadé.

Formations

  • Aston University (Birmingham)

    Birmingham 1999 - 2000 Bayesian network

    Thèse sur les "Small loops in Gallager error correcting codes"

    MSc Neural Network and Pattern Analysis (NCRG)
  • Institut D'Informatique D'Entreprise IIE Evry

    Evry 1997 - 2000 Réseaux - Systèmes d'Information

    Dernière année réalisée à Aston University (Birmingham, UK)
  • Lycée Gustave Eiffel

    Dijon 1995 - 1997 Sup PTSI - Spé PSI
  • Lycée Hippolyte Fontaine (Dijon)

    Dijon 1992 - 1995 Série S. Spécialité Math et Industriel

Réseau

Annuaire des membres :